In the 9 matches CCV has started for Ipswich - 5 goals conceded. 4 clean sheets, and a single goal conceded in 5 matches.

Prior to CCV, Ipswich conceded 39 in 27 league matches.

Since they played in my neck of the woods I got to watch him and he was quite close to me the first half. Miazga was clearly the more vocal one and organized the back line with CCV deputizing some on set pieces. The yellow was quite comically soft but at that point the ref had lost a bit of control of the game and probably assumed something more malicious happened after a series of cheap fouls by Paraguay.

They hardly challenged the US line except from set pieces. His ball control was solid as was his short range passing. His long range passes mostly failed. Overall a good performance and he has improved quite a lot since the last time I saw him. Still seems a far stretch from Spurs quality. I could see him stepping up to a lower PL loan next season if that is on the cards.
